Abstract

The utility model relates to the security protection field, in particular to an infrared and mobile phone mixed positioning device for a security protection system, which comprises a host machine, wherein a temperature sensor is fixedly connected with the inner side of the top end surface of the host machine, an air box is fixedly connected with the top of the left end surface of the host machine, the right end surface of the air box is communicated with an air inlet pipe, the air inlet pipe penetrates through the host machine, and the air inlet pipe is fixedly connected with the host machine. Description

Infrared and mobile phone mixed positioning device for security system
Technical Field
The utility model relates to a security protection field specifically is a security protection system mixes positioner with infrared and cell-phone.
Background
With the development of information technology, information-based systems are applied to various technical fields, management of offices and personnel by enterprises is higher and higher, when safety management is performed on outsiders, infrared and mobile phone mixed positioning and safety management are performed on outsiders moving in an office area by controlling infrared monitoring positioning equipment in the office area and positioning mobile phones of the outsiders through a host of a control terminal, but some existing infrared and mobile phone mixed positioning devices have problems when used, some existing infrared and mobile phone mixed positioning control terminal hosts generate heat when used for a long time, some existing control terminal hosts cannot dissipate heat when used, the internal temperature of the control terminal hosts is high, electronic elements in the control terminal hosts are easily damaged, use is influenced, and some existing control terminal hosts, especially small control terminal hosts, do not use when used The host machine of the small-sized control terminal is light in weight, so that a user can easily knock down the host machine of the control terminal during use, a connecting wire connected with the host machine of the control terminal can be loosened and fall off, and the use is influenced.

Compared with the prior art, the beneficial effects of the utility model are that:
1. in the utility model, through the arranged bellows, the air inlet pipe and the fan, when the temperature sensor in the host computer senses that the temperature in the host computer is high during use, the temperature sensor controls the fan to rotate through the controller, the fan rotates to pull gas to enter the host computer through the air inlet pipe for heat dissipation after dust impurities are filtered out through the filter screen, thereby when the temperature in the host computer is high during use, the heat can be dissipated in the host computer in time, electronic elements in the host computer can not be damaged, and the use is not influenced;
2. the utility model discloses in, through the handle that sets up, screw shaft and sucking disc, during the use, drive the screw shaft through rotating the handle and rotate, the screw shaft rotates and drives the slide and slide, the slide slides and drives the motion of first hole, let first hole, second hole and sucking disc stagger, close the inlet channel of sucking disc, press the host computer, under the effect of sucking disc, can fix the host computer absorption firmly subaerial, thereby can fix the host computer during the use, the condition that is knocked down can not appear in the host computer, connecting wire on the host computer can not drop, do not influence the use.
Drawings
FIG. 1 is a schematic view of the overall structure of the present invention;
FIG. 2 is a schematic view of the mounting structure of the check valve of the present invention;
FIG. 3 is a schematic view of the installation structure of the filter screen of the present invention;
fig. 4 is a left side view of the fixing plate of the present invention.
In the figure: 1-a host, 2-a temperature sensor, 3-an air box, 4-an air inlet pipe, 5-a support rod, 6-a fan, 7-a filter screen, 8-a limit plate, 9-a push rod, 10-a spring, 11-an air outlet pipe, 12-a one-way valve, 13-a controller, 14-a fixed plate, 15-a handle, 16-a threaded shaft, 17-a sliding plate, 18-a first hole, 19-a second hole and 20-a sucker.
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ides a technical solution:
an infrared and mobile phone mixed positioning device for a security system comprises a host 1, a temperature sensor 2 is fixedly connected to the inner side of the top end face of the host 1, a bellows 3 is fixedly connected to the top of the left end face of the host 1, the right end face of the bellows 3 is communicated with an air inlet pipe 4, the air inlet pipe 4 penetrates through the host 1, the air inlet pipe 4 is fixedly connected with the host 1, a support rod 5 is fixedly connected to the central position of the inner side of the bellows 3, a fan 6 is fixedly connected to the outer side of the support rod 5, the host 1 is convenient to radiate heat, a filter screen 7 is slidably connected to the left end of the inner side of the bellows 3, the filter screen 7 penetrates through the bellows 3, dust and sundries in gas drawn by the fan 6 can be filtered by the arrangement, the dust and sundries are prevented from entering the host 1 and damaging the host 1, a controller 13 is fixedly connected to the central position of, the front end surface of the fixing plate 14 is rotatably connected with a handle 15, and the handle 15 penetrates through the fixing plate 14.
The top of the right end face of the main machine 1 is communicated with an air outlet pipe 11, the inner side of the air outlet pipe 11 is provided with a one-way valve 12, and external dust and sundries can be prevented from entering the main machine 1 while ventilation is realized; the top end face of the filter screen 7 is slidably connected with a limiting plate 8, the limiting plate 8 penetrates through the air box 3, the limiting plate 8 is slidably connected with the air box 3, the right side of the top end face of the limiting plate 8 is fixedly connected with a push rod 9, the push rod 9 penetrates through the air box 3, the push rod 9 is slidably connected with the air box 3, and the left side of the top end face of the limiting plate 8 is obliquely arranged and can drive the limiting plate 8 to leave the filter screen 7, so that the filter screen 7 can be conveniently detached; the spring 10 is arranged on the right end face of the limiting plate 8, the spring 10 is fixedly connected with the limiting plate 8, the other end of the spring 10 is fixedly connected with the air box 3, and the limiting plate 8 can be automatically driven to reset to limit and fix the filter screen 7; the rear end face of the handle 15 is fixedly connected with a threaded shaft 16, the outer side of the threaded shaft 16 is spirally connected with a sliding plate 17, the sliding plate 17 is in sliding connection with the fixing plate 14, a first hole 18 is formed in the inner side of the sliding plate 17, a second hole 19 is formed in the top end face of the fixing plate 14, the bottom end face of the fixing plate 14 is communicated with a sucker 20, the arrangement can enable the first hole 18, the second hole 19 and the sucker 20 to be staggered, and an air inlet channel of the sucker 20 is closed.
The working process is as follows: when the device is used, a host 1 of a control terminal of the infrared and mobile phone mixed positioning device controls the infrared and mobile phone mixed positioning device to position and safely manage external personnel moving in an office area, when the host 1 is used, firstly, a handle 15 is rotated to drive a threaded shaft 16 to rotate, the threaded shaft 16 rotates to drive a sliding plate 17 to slide, the sliding plate 17 slides to drive a first hole 18 to move, the first hole 18, a second hole 19 and a sucker 20 are staggered, an air inlet channel of the sucker 20 is closed, the host 1 is pressed, the host 1 can be firmly adsorbed and fixed on the ground under the action of the sucker 20, so that the host 1 can be fixed during use, the host 1 cannot be knocked down, when a temperature sensor 2 in the host 1 senses high temperature inside the host 1 during use, the temperature sensor 2 controls a fan 6 to rotate through a controller 13, the fan 6 rotates to pull gas to filter dust impurities through the filter screen 7 and then enter the host 1 through the air inlet pipe 4 for heat dissipation, so that when the temperature in the host 1 is high, the heat can be dissipated in time in the host 1, because the filter screen 7 often filters the dust impurities in the gas pulled by the fan 6, the filter screen 7 is easy to block, the filter screen 7 needs to be periodically disassembled and cleaned, the limit plate 8 is driven to leave the filter screen 7 by pulling the push rod 9, when the limit plate 8 is not in contact with the filter screen 7, the filter screen 7 can be disassembled, the filter screen 7 is cleaned, after the filter screen 7 is cleaned, the filter screen 7 is placed at the top end of the limit plate 8, the filter screen 7 is pressed, the limit plate 8 is extruded by the filter screen 7 to drive the limit plate 8 to move, the limit plate 8 can compress the spring 10, when the filter screen 7 is in contact with the bottom of the bellows 3, the filter screen 7 is installed, when the host 1 needs to be moved, the reverse rotation handle 15 drives the sliding plate 17 and the first hole 18 to reset, the air inlet suction force inside the sucker 20 is reduced, the fixation of the host 1 can be released, and the host 1 is moved.
